2015 GOALS
DAILY
Keep on top of your spirituality.
Go to sleep early and wake up early.
Do at least 1 hour of work/studying every day.
Journaling in the morning and at night before bedtime.
Planning for the next day in the evening.
Sufficient water intake.
WEEKLY
One day of computer/phone detox. Only answer urgent phone calls or mails.
Date night.
Exercise 2-3 days a week.
Have two days of self-care.
Keep your home clean.
Call or write to your loved ones. Let them know you're thinking about them.
Organize papers and documents every week.
MONTHLY
Make something with your hands once a month.
Keep a journal for future project ideas.
Go over the month and write down how you can improve the next month.
Set monthly goals.
Read at least one book each month.

My Ultimate Packing List
DOCUMENTS
All the necessary documents such as passports, visas, plane tickets, and extra copies of all these documents just in case.
CLOTHING
Depends on the season and for how long you're travelling, but whatever you get the most wear out of in your usual life is a safe bet to bring with you when travelling. Don't overpack, there is a chance you will not wear half of the clothes you brought.
For winter I like to bring: 5 undies, 2 bras, leggings, one pair of jeans, 1 dress, 1 skirt, about 3-4 sweaters, tank top and a cardigan, 2 pairs of socks, and 2 scarves. Everything else I will wear on myself.
COSMETICS
Skin and Body Care essentials: cleanser, moisturizer, eye cream, body butter, toothbrush and toothpaste.
Makeup: mascara, foundation/concealer, a small eyeshadow palette, lipstick
ELECTRONICS
Chargers (+plug adapter if needed), camera, epilator
WHAT'S IN MY CARRY-ON
Laptop, planner+notebook+pen, a cosmetics bag with face powder, lip balm, lipstick, face mist and hand cream, passport and airplane tickets, phone.
